#76947e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#76947e is composed of 46.3% red, 58%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 136 degrees, a saturation of 12.3% and a lightness of 52.2%. #76947e color hex could be obtained by blending #ecfffc with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#76947e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#76947e has RGB values of R:118, G:148,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7771262.

Shades and Tints of #76947e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050605 is the darkest color, while #fafbfa is the lightest one.
